Different Types of Innovation in Business and Their Impact on Success


Innovation and creativity are the lifeblood of entrepreneurship. They are the driving forces behind the creation of new products, services, and business models that disrupt industries and create economic growth. The term "Different Types of Innovation in Business and Their Impact on Success" encapsulates the variety of ways in which entrepreneurs can innovate to achieve success.


To begin with, there are four broad types of innovation: product innovation, process innovation, marketing innovation, and organizational innovation. Product innovation refers to creating a new product or significantly improving an existing one. This could mean introducing a product that is entirely new to the market or making substantial improvements to an existing product's performance or designed user experience.


Process innovation involves changes in how businesses do things. It may involve implementing new procedures or methodologies to improve efficiency, quality, or production speed. For instance, Henry Ford's introduction of the assembly line was a revolutionary process innovation that drastically increased productivity.


Marketing innovation refers to novel methods in marketing strategies including packaging design, pricing strategy, promotion methods etc., which enhance brand recognition and reach out effectively to potential consumers.


Organizational innovation involves introducing new practices within a business that have not been used before. These might include changes in internal processes such as human resources management practices or external relations like collaborations with other firms.


Each type of these innovations has different impacts on business success. Product innovations can allow companies to differentiate themselves from competitors and command higher prices for their unique offerings. Process innovations can lead to cost savings through improved efficiency or quality that reduces waste and rework. Marketing innovations can help businesses reach new audiences or better serve existing ones leading to increased sales. Organizational innovations can increase employee morale and productivity by creating a more engaging work environment.


However, it is not enough just to innovate; businesses must also manage their innovations effectively for them to have maximum impact on success. This includes protecting intellectual property rights through patents where applicable, ensuring buy-in from all staff members involved in implementing innovations, and continually monitoring and adjusting innovations based on feedback from customers and market performance.


In conclusion, there are various types of innovation available to entrepreneurs each with its unique potential to drive business success. By understanding these different types and their impacts, entrepreneurs can strategically employ the most appropriate form for their specific circumstances, thereby enhancing their chances of achieving sustainable business growth and success. Case Studies: Successful Businesses That Have Embraced Innovation and Creativity


Innovation and creativity are two crucial elements that drive entrepreneurship. They are the driving forces behind groundbreaking business ideas and advancements, pushing the boundaries of what is possible and transforming industries as we know them. This essay explores a number of case studies that demonstrate how successful businesses have embraced innovation and creativity in their entrepreneurial journey.


Google is arguably one of the most innovative companies in the world. Since its inception, Google has consistently pushed the envelope, reinventing itself and introducing new products that have revolutionized digital technology. From developing the world's most popular search engine to pioneering self-driving cars with Waymo, Google's success can largely be attributed to its culture of innovation and creativity.


Another great example is SpaceX, an aerospace manufacturer founded by Elon Musk. SpaceX has reshaped space travel through its innovative approach to rocket manufacturing and launch services. By designing reusable rockets, SpaceX has significantly reduced the cost of space exploration. This level of creative thinking has positioned SpaceX as a leader in private space travel.


On a smaller scale but no less impressive is Warby Parker, an eyewear company that disrupted the traditional eyeglasses industry with its direct-to-consumer business model. By cutting out middlemen, Warby Parker was able to provide fashionable glasses at a fraction of traditional retail prices. Their innovative use of online platforms for virtual try-on also enabled them to reach a wider audience.


Furthermore, Airbnb is another shining example in this realm. It transformed the hospitality industry by creating a platform where people could rent out their homes or rooms for short-term stays. This innovative concept challenged traditional hotel models and created new opportunities for homeowners while offering travelers unique accommodations.


Lastly, Uber's innovation changed our perception of transportation services forever by connecting drivers with riders directly via smartphone app bypassing taxi companies completely. Their disruptive strategy democratized access to personal transportation and reshaped urban mobility.


In conclusion, these businesses have demonstrated how embracing innovation and creativity can lead to phenomenal success in entrepreneurship. They have challenged the status quo, disrupted traditional industries, and created new markets by thinking outside of the box. The success stories of Google, SpaceX, Warby Parker, Airbnb, and Uber serve as an inspiration for aspiring entrepreneurs to innovate and think creatively in their ventures. As these case studies show, innovation and creativity are key ingredients in the recipe for entrepreneurial success.

Challenges to Implementing Innovation and Creativity in Entrepreneurship


Innovation and creativity are vital elements in entrepreneurship. They play a critical role in driving business growth, enhancing competitiveness, and addressing modern-day challenges. However, implementing innovation and creativity in an entrepreneurial setting is not without its obstacles. There are several challenges that entrepreneurs face when trying to introduce innovative and creative ideas into their businesses.


One of the major barriers to implementing innovation is resistance to change. In many cases, employees, stakeholders or even the entrepreneurs themselves may resist new ideas or processes due to fear of the unknown or comfort with the status quo. This resistance often stems from concerns about job security or apprehensions about adapting to new technologies or procedures.


Another challenge lies in securing necessary resources for innovation such as time, money, and skilled personnel. Innovation is often a costly process requiring significant investment not just financially but also in terms of time and human resources. Many startups operate on tight budgets and timelines which can make it difficult for them to allocate sufficient resources towards research and development of innovative products or services.


The lack of a creative culture within an organization can also hinder the implementation of innovative ideas. Companies need to foster an environment that encourages risk-taking, experimentation, and learning from failures all prerequisites for innovation. Without a supportive environment where employees feel empowered to propose new ideas without fear of criticism or punishment, it becomes difficult for creativity and innovation to thrive.


In addition, market uncertainty poses another significant challenge for implementing innovation in entrepreneurship. The success of an innovative product or service is largely dependent on how it's received by customers who are often unpredictable in their preferences. Entrepreneurs may hesitate to invest heavily in untested innovations due their uncertain return on investment.


Finally, navigating legal complexities related with patents rights protection can be daunting for many entrepreneurs wanting to innovate. Intellectual property laws vary widely around the world making it tricky for businesses operating internationally to protect their innovations from being replicated by competitors.


Despite these challenges though, successful implementation of creativity and innovation is not an impossible feat. By fostering a culture of innovation, securing sufficient resources, managing change effectively and navigating market uncertainties, entrepreneurs can overcome these barriers and harness the power of creativity and innovation to drive their business success. Nonetheless, understanding these potential challenges is crucial for entrepreneurs as they strive to innovate in their business operations.
